Oh, and ANOTHER tip is to divide your work up into three themes: the theme of diet (how much can you learn about what the body does with food?), the theme of training (what work will cause the body to respond in the way you want), and the theme of integration (how do guys incorporate all their knowledge and still have a "life"; how do they make bodybuilding work FOR THEM, instead of working FOR bodybuilding?). Bodybuilding is a complex, interwoven system, so treat it as such from the outset.
